JUDGES OF THE COURT OF CLAIMS IN 1916

ADOLPH J. RODENBECK,1 Presiding Judge, Rochester, N. Y. FRED M. ACKERSON, Presiding Judge, Niagara Falls, N. Y. WILLIAM W. WEBB, Judge, Rochester, N. Y.

THOMAS F. FENNELL, Judge, Elmira, N. Y.

CHARLES R. PARIS, Judge, Hudson Falls, N. Y.

WILLIAM D. CUNNINGHAM, Judge, Ellenville, N. Y.

1 On March 3, 1916, Judge Rodenbeck resigned from the Court of Claims by reason of his appointment by the Governor as a supreme court justice in the seventh judicial district.

Judge Ackerson, who was appointed a judge of the Court of Claims on February 10, 1915, was designated by the Governor on March 6, 1916, as presiding judge to succeed Judge Rodenbeck.

3 Appointed on March 6, 1916, by the Governor to fill the unexpired term of Judge Rodenbeck.

4 Appointed on April 19, 1915, by the Governor as an additional judge pursuant to section 282 of the Code of Civil Procedure.

5 Appointed on December 29, 1915, by the Governor as an additional judge pursuant to section 282 of the Code of Civil Procedure.
